Has anyone used the SWAT GUI interface to Samba. If enbable, you can access
Samba configuration through an HTML GUI on port 901. However, this passes
root authentication when logging in. So, since I can only access my Cobalt
RaQ3 through a public IP address, I need to do it securely. I tried
generating an SSL cert for the server, but port 901 just hangs when trying
to access using 'https'. Does anyone use this config utility? How are you
accessing it securely? Or maybe how to get the SSL to work?
